5 Advantages of Blind Advertisement in Real Estate

Blind advertising in real estate refers to the practice of withholding specific property details, such as the address or exact location, in advertisements. The following are some of the benefits of blind advertising in real estate.
1. Privacy and Security
Blind advertising can help protect the privacy and security of property owners. By not disclosing the exact location, it reduces the risk of unwanted visitors or potential security threats.
2. Exclusivity and Curiosity
Withholding specific property details can create a sense of exclusivity and curiosity among potential buyers. This can generate more interest and inquiries, potentially leading to a higher demand for the property.
3. Pre-qualification of Buyers
Blind advertising can attract serious and qualified buyers who are genuinely interested in the property rather than those who are simply curious about the location. This can save time and effort for both sellers and real estate agents.
4. Negotiation Power
By not disclosing the property details upfront, sellers may have an advantage during negotiations. They can control the flow of information and potentially negotiate better terms or prices.
5. Market Testing
Blind advertising can be useful for testing the market's response to a property without fully committing to a public listing. It allows sellers to gauge interest and gather feedback before deciding on a more traditional marketing approach.
It's important to note that blind advertising may not be suitable for all types of properties or markets. It's advisable to consult with local real estate professionals who have experience in the African market to determine if this approach aligns with your specific goals and circumstances.
